Three-Dimensional Hierarchical Hydrotalcite-Silica Sphere Composites as Catalysts for Baeyer-Villiger Oxidation Reactions Using Hydrogen Peroxide

摘要
The development of effective, environmentally friendly catalysts for the Baeyer-Villiger reaction is becoming increasingly important in applied catalysis. In this work, we synthesized a 3D composite consisting of silica spheres coated with Mg/Al hydrotalcite with much better textural properties than its 2D counterparts. In fact, the 3D solid outperformed a 2D-layered hydrotalcite as catalyst in the Baeyer-Villiger reaction of cyclic ketones with H2O2/benzonitrile as oxidant. The 3D catalyst provided excellent conversion and selectivity; it was also readily filtered off the reaction mixture. The proposed reaction mechanism, which involves adsorption of the reactants on the hydrotalcite surface, is consistent with the catalytic activity results.
